SEATech Ventures Corp. Finalizes Rebranding to 'AleeanPeace Group Holdings Limited' and New Ticker
Summary
SEATech Ventures Corp. filed a definitive information statement to formalize its rebranding to "AleeanPeace Group Holdings Limited" and change its ticker symbol, signaling a new business direction amidst ongoing financial distress.

Definitive Rebranding Approved
Majority shareholders (68.674%) have formally approved the change of the company name to "AleeanPeace Group Holdings Limited" and a new trading symbol, following a preliminary announcement on May 4, 2026.

Formalization and Timeline
This definitive filing formalizes the previously announced action, with the changes expected to become effective 20 days after distribution, pending FINRA approval.

Analysis
This definitive information statement formalizes SEATech Ventures Corp.'s previously announced rebranding, confirming the name change to "AleeanPeace Group Holdings Limited" and a new trading symbol. This action, approved by majority shareholders, signals a strategic pivot towards a new business direction. The formalization of this change is notable given the company's recent disclosures of substantial doubt about its ability to continue as a going concern. While a name change alone does not resolve financial distress, it represents a formal attempt to reset perception and strategy. The CEO's lack of share ownership, however, may temper investor confidence in this new direction.
At the time of this filing, SEAV was trading at $0.08 on OTC in the Trade & Services sector, with a market capitalization of approximately $3.5M. The 52-week trading range was $0.01 to $0.82. This filing was assessed with neutral market sentiment and an importance score of 7 out of 10.
